Sri Lanka, Dec. 24 -- The Indian chase defined the concept of a walk in the park, with Shafali Verma's scintillating unbeaten 69 off 34 balls anchoring a 129-run pursuit that did the job with 49 balls to spare.
Be it the slow burn of the first T20I or the swift mercy of the second, the outcome remained the same, with a seven-wicket win for India at the ACA-VDCA Stadium in Visakhapatnam helping it take a 2-0 lead in the five-match series.
Perhaps more importantly, though, the evening marked a quiet redemption for Sree Charani.
